Yafang ShaoandNathan Chancellor e5a259d988 kbuild: rpm-pkg: Preserve BTF sections in kernel modules during debuginfo stripping
After switching to the kernel's default package scripts for our local
kernel RPM builds, we noticed that module BTF entries were missing:

  $ ls /sys/kernel/btf/
  vmlinux    <<<< only vmlinux, no module BTF

Root cause: find-debuginfo.sh (from the debugedit package) prefers
eu-strip over strip when elfutils is installed, which is the common
case on RHEL 9. eu-strip removes non-allocated ELF sections, including
the .BTF section that contains BPF Type Format information for kernel
modules. Without .BTF, BPF tools (bpftool, bcc, bpftrace) cannot resolve
kernel types at runtime, and /sys/kernel/btf/<module> entries are not
created when modules are loaded.

Additionally, since commit 8646db2389 ("libbpf,bpf: Share BTF
relocate-related code with kernel"), modules contain a .BTF.base section
that maps distilled type IDs to vmlinux types. If .BTF.base is stripped,
btf_parse_module() falls back to vmlinux BTF directly, causing type ID
mismatches and rejecting the module's BTF entirely.

Fix by passing --keep-section .BTF and --keep-section .BTF.base via
_find_debuginfo_opts, which adds -K .BTF and -K .BTF.base to the
eu-strip/strip command, preserving both sections while allowing normal
debuginfo extraction to proceed.

After this change, all module BTF files are properly generated:

%if %{with_debuginfo_rpm}
# list of debuginfo-related options taken from distribution kernel.spec
# files
%undefine _include_minidebuginfo
%undefine _find_debuginfo_dwz_opts
%undefine _unique_build_ids
%undefine _unique_debug_names
%undefine _unique_debug_srcs
%undefine _debugsource_packages
%undefine _debuginfo_subpackages
# Preserve .BTF and .BTF.base sections in kernel modules during debuginfo
# stripping. find-debuginfo.sh uses eu-strip which removes non-allocated ELF
# sections like .BTF by default. .BTF.base is required for BTF distillation
# support; without it, module BTF validation fails.
%global with_keep_section %(%{__find_debuginfo} --help 2>&1 | grep -c keep-section)
%if %{with_keep_section}
%global _find_debuginfo_opts -r --keep-section .BTF --keep-section .BTF.base
%else
%global _find_debuginfo_opts -r
%endif
%global _missing_build_ids_terminate_build 1
%global _no_recompute_build_ids 1
%{debug_package}
# later, we make all modules executable so that find-debuginfo.sh strips
# them up. but they don't actually need to be executable, so remove the
# executable bit, taking care to do it _after_ find-debuginfo.sh has run
%define __spec_install_post \
%{?__debug_package:%{__debug_install_post}} \
%{__arch_install_post} \
%{__os_install_post} \
find %{buildroot}/lib/modules/%{KERNELRELEASE} -name "*.ko" -type f \\\
| xargs --no-run-if-empty chmod u-x
%else
%define __spec_install_post /usr/lib/rpm/brp-compress || :
%endif
# some (but not all) versions of rpmbuild emit %%debug_package with
# %%install. since we've already emitted it manually, that would cause
# a package redefinition error. ensure that doesn't happen
%define debug_package %{nil}
